Definitions:

Freud's Personality Model

A theory suggesting personality is composed of the id, ego, and superego, balancing basic desires, realistic decisions, and moral constraints, respectively.

Ego

A component of the psyche associated with self-perception, self-esteem, and the management of personal identity.

Superego

The component of Freud's psychoanalytic theory acting as the moral compass or conscience within the personality.

Freud

Sigmund Freud, from Austria and a pioneering neurologist, created psychoanalysis as a dialogue-based treatment method for mental health conditions.
